**Vendor note: Inkmill markdown pipeline**

Rendering for Parchway docs is outsourced to Inkmill under an annual contract, renewing each March. They handle sanitization and PDF export; we own the upload queue. SLA: 4-hour response on rendering failures. Escalate only after two failed retries. Their support desk is reachable at the address below.

billing contact of hahaf-baguf = zorael.tammir.jorius@sivrelhq.internal

The Lintgrove scanner for Project Amberquay compares each run against a committed baseline file so legacy findings don't block builds. `BASELINE_PATH` points at the file; `BASELINE_STRICT=1` fails the run if the baseline is missing rather than regenerating it, which is the safe default for support-triggered reruns. Never edit the baseline by hand — regenerate it via the `refresh-baseline` task. Uploading results to the Amberquay dashboard requires an API secret, which is set on the next line.

sealed setting: RELAY_SECRET5=82864

Management Meeting Minutes — Askerby Holdings

Present: senior leadership; prepared for the incoming director. The meeting reviewed the proposed sale of the Fenwrick Coatings unit. Due diligence by the Lorimund advisory group is complete, and valuation ranges were discussed at length. Staff consultation timelines were agreed, with branch communications to follow contract signature. The board asked that the incoming director review the strategic rationale, which is summarised in the note below.

confidential, kagup-bafog: Fraaxax Group is in early talks to buy Soroxox Group for about $343.8 million. The Olidor launch date is June 14, and nothing goes to the press before then. Legal wants the Aldmirek Logistics term sheet signed before July 23.

## Deployment

Soft deletes on the Merrowfield orders table are enforced at the service layer, not the database, so deploys must ship the filter middleware and the schema flag together. A partial rollout will resurface tombstoned orders in reports, which is what bit us in the Averlyn incident. Before promoting any build, confirm the deployment environment carries the settings listed below.

settings of fafog-haduf:
ZORIX_PIN=4648
ZORIX_METRICS_HOST=metrics.zorix.paliqsys.corp
ZORIX_LOG_LEVEL=info
ZORIX_TENANT=druix